Harsh Environments: The Real Challenge for Flexible Signs
Flexible signs installed on highways and open-road networks are constantly exposed to conditions that directly affect their service life. High temperatures can cause conventional materials to crack or deform, while strong winds may bend or topple rigid signs. In addition, vehicle impacts caused by lane deviation or reduced visibility pose a serious threat to traditional signage.
Under such conditions, conventional rigid signs often become weak points within the road safety system. Instead of serving as guidance tools, they may turn into solid obstacles that increase accident severity. This challenge has driven the need for traffic signs that can adapt rather than resist through rigidity.

The Concept of Flexibility in Flexible Sign Design
Flexibility in traffic signs goes beyond simple bending. It refers to the ability to absorb impact energy, withstand environmental stress, and return to the original position without losing shape, visibility, or function. This performance is achieved through advanced engineering materials that combine strength with elasticity, allowing the sign to respond intelligently to external forces.
When a flexible sign is exposed to strong winds or sudden impact, it does not break or collapse. Instead, it bends at a controlled angle and then recovers its original position, maintaining both structural integrity and clear traffic messaging.

How Flexible Signs Respond to Vehicle Impacts
In the event of a vehicle collision, flexible signs do not behave as rigid obstacles that abruptly stop the vehicle. Instead, they absorb and dissipate impact energy. This energy absorption prevents the sign from breaking and reduces the severity of damage to the vehicle and its occupants. It also eliminates the risk of broken sign components becoming hazardous debris on the roadway.
This approach reflects a fundamental shift in road safety philosophy—from resisting impact to managing it intelligently to minimize damage and protect lives.
Resistance to Extreme Climatic Conditions
One of the most significant advantages of flexible traffic signs is their ability to perform reliably under harsh climatic conditions. The materials used in their construction are resistant to ultraviolet radiation, preventing color fading and material degradation over time. They are also capable of withstanding wide temperature fluctuations without cracking or losing mechanical properties.
These characteristics make flexible signs particularly suitable for desert highways, coastal roads, and open high-speed routes, where traditional signage often deteriorates more quickly.


Visual Clarity and Long-Term Performance
In addition to durability and flexibility, flexible traffic signs maintain high levels of visual clarity. They are typically integrated with premium reflective sheeting that ensures excellent visibility at night and in low-light conditions. Because the sign remains upright and undistorted, the traffic message stays clear and legible over extended periods.
This consistency in performance reduces the need for frequent maintenance and ensures uninterrupted guidance and warning for road users.
Long-Term Cost Efficiency of Flexible Signs
From a long-term perspective, flexible traffic signs significantly reduce operational and maintenance costs. Rather than requiring repeated replacement after impacts or environmental damage, flexible signs continue to perform effectively even after multiple stress events. Furthermore, by reducing accident severity, they indirectly lower infrastructure repair costs and associated downtime.
As a result, flexible signs evolve from being simple guidance elements into long-term investments in road safety and infrastructure efficiency.
Flexible Signs as Part of a Safety System
Flexible traffic signs do not function in isolation. They are designed to integrate seamlessly with other road safety components such as barriers, reflective road markings, and intelligent warning systems. When properly incorporated into the overall road design, they contribute to creating a safer, more adaptive traffic environment capable of handling diverse operational scenarios.
